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76 57 7313007402
10378756 76485531888
10378756 76485531888
58868 765 177617662
All about undefined
Interested in learning more?
10378756 76485531888
58868 765 177617662
See more
27 726 48403237768
96993 5863522 8827581
See more
22074010 89694898 7454
176 9368852 40 1539627
See more